Practical Applications

The synergy between biotechnology and technology tools can translate into measurable impacts on industries ranging from healthcare to agriculture. Here are a few practical applications:

Healthcare

  1. Drug Discovery: With automated tools, researchers can simulate drug interactions virtually, reducing the time and cost of trials.
  2. Personalized Medicine: AI tools analyze genetic data to create tailored medical treatments.

Agriculture

  1. Crop Optimization: AI-driven prediction tools can determine the best conditions for crop growth, boosting agricultural sustainability.
  2. Pest Management: Real-time monitoring with IoT and AI tools helps in managing and mitigating pest invasions.
